Portable PDF2OFX: Convert Receipts to OFX AnywhereIn an era when financial tracking and bookkeeping increasingly happen away from the office, having reliable tools that convert paper or PDF receipts into bank-ready transaction files is essential. Portable PDF2OFX is a class of lightweight, mobile-friendly utilities designed to extract transaction data from PDFs and transform it into the OFX (Open Financial Exchange) format, which can be imported directly into most personal finance and accounting software. This article explains what Portable PDF2OFX tools do, why they matter, how they work, when to use them, and best practices to get accurate results.
What is OFX and why it matters
OFX (Open Financial Exchange) is a standardized file format used for exchanging financial data between banks, accounting software, and personal finance applications. Most desktop and cloud-based bookkeeping programs—such as Quicken, QuickBooks (with import utilities), GnuCash, and many bank portals—support OFX or can convert OFX to their preferred import format. OFX preserves structured transaction data (date, amount, payee, memo, type), making it far superior to raw PDFs for automated reconciliation and categorization.
What Portable PDF2OFX tools do
Portable PDF2OFX tools focus specifically on converting PDF receipts, bank statements, or exported PDFs from web banking into OFX transaction files. Core functions usually include:
- PDF parsing and optical character recognition (OCR) to read text from images or scanned receipts.
- Field extraction to identify dates, amounts, payees, and transaction types.
- Mapping and normalization to format extracted data into OFX-compliant fields.
- Exporting a ready-to-import OFX file, sometimes with options for CSV or QIF as well.
Many portable versions are packaged as single executables or lightweight apps that run from a USB drive or as small installers with minimal dependencies, enabling on-the-go conversion without heavy system setup.
Why portability matters
Portability brings several practical benefits:
- Flexibility to work from any machine without full installation or admin rights.
- Quick conversions during travel, at client sites, or at bookkeeping appointments.
- Reduced footprint for privacy-focused users who prefer not to leave software traces on shared computers.
- Often cross-platform compatibility (Windows portable executables, small Linux binaries, or macOS packages).
For professionals who handle receipts in the field—bookkeepers, accountants, freelancers, and small business owners—being able to convert receipts immediately reduces manual entry errors and speeds up reconciliation.
How Portable PDF2OFX works — steps & techniques
- Input acquisition: The tool accepts PDFs saved from email, mobile scans, or banking portals. Some accept single receipts, others batch multiple pages.
- OCR/text extraction: If a PDF is an image, OCR engines (Tesseract or commercial OCR) convert images to text. For digital PDFs, embedded text is parsed directly.
- Pattern recognition: Regular expressions and heuristics detect dates (various formats), currency amounts (including negative amounts for refunds), and payee/memo lines.
- Data normalization: Extracted values are normalized to ISO-like date formats and standard decimal separators, and currencies are mapped.
- OFX construction: The tool wraps transactions into an OFX-compliant XML envelope with account info, transaction IDs, and balances where available.
- Validation & export: The final file is validated for basic OFX structure and offered for download or saved to disk for import into finance software.
Some advanced tools add machine learning models to improve payee recognition, category suggestions, or to auto-correct OCR mistakes based on context.
Common use cases
- Importing business receipts into accounting software for expense reporting.
- Converting bank PDF statements for personal finance apps that accept OFX.
- Migrating historical PDF records into bookkeeping systems during audits or bookkeeping transitions.
- Quick reconciliation for freelancers who scan receipts immediately after purchases.
Accuracy challenges and limitations
- Poor scan quality or complex layouts can reduce OCR accuracy.
- Receipts with handwritten notes or unusual formats may require manual correction.
- Missing fields: some receipts lack merchant names or clear dates, forcing guesswork.
- Currency and locale differences (commas vs periods, date order) can cause parsing errors.
- OFX supports structured accounts; if account IDs or balances are absent, the OFX file may be less useful for full reconciliation.
Expect to review and correct a portion of converted transactions — accuracy rates vary by source quality and tool sophistication.
Best practices for reliable conversion
- Use high-quality scans (300 dpi recommended) and save as searchable PDFs when possible.
- Batch-scan receipts by merchant or date to simplify parsing patterns.
- Review OCR output before export; correct misread payees and amounts.
- Standardize PDF naming to include date and account hints (e.g., 2025-08-15_Expenses.pdf).
- Keep a short verification workflow: import into a test account first to ensure fields map correctly.
- If using a portable executable on shared machines, run in an isolated folder and securely delete temporary files after use.
Security & privacy considerations
Portable tools that run locally keep data off servers, which is preferable for sensitive financial information. When using cloud-based OCR or conversion services, verify their privacy practices and encryption. If carrying a portable app on removable media, encrypt the drive or container to protect receipts if the device is lost.
Choosing the right Portable PDF2OFX tool
Consider:
- OCR quality (Tesseract vs commercial engines).
- Batch processing and supported PDF types (scanned vs digital).
- Output options (OFX version, CSV, QIF).
- Portability format (single EXE, AppImage, portable ZIP).
- Platform compatibility and minimal dependencies.
- Privacy model (local-only vs cloud-processing).
Compare candidates by testing a representative sample of your receipts and measuring accuracy and time to correct errors.
Feature | Benefit |
---|---|
Local OCR support | Keeps data off the cloud; faster on-device processing |
Batch conversion | Saves time for many receipts |
Customizable mappings | Ensures payees/categories match your accounting plan |
Portable single-file binary | Runs without installation or admin rights |
OFX validation | Reduces import failures in finance software |
Troubleshooting common issues
- Wrong date parsing: check locale/date-order settings and provide examples for custom parsing rules.
- Split line items: some receipts list multiple taxes/fees; configure the tool to aggregate or keep separate.
- Encoding errors in OFX: ensure UTF-8 or required character encoding is set during export.
- Import failure in finance app: validate OFX structure with a viewer or try exporting as CSV/QIF and importing through alternate routes.
Example workflow (quick)
- Scan receipts with a mobile scanner app; save as searchable PDFs.
- Copy PDFs to a USB drive containing the Portable PDF2OFX executable.
- Run the portable tool, batch-import PDFs, review OCR results.
- Export OFX file and import into accounting software for reconciliation.
- Archive original PDFs and securely remove temporary files.
Conclusion
Portable PDF2OFX utilities bridge the gap between paper receipts and digital accounting by converting unstructured PDF data into OFX files ready for import. They’re especially valuable for mobile professionals and privacy-conscious users. While OCR and layout variability mean some manual review is usually needed, a portable tool that matches your receipt types can drastically cut data-entry time and improve bookkeeping accuracy.
Leave a Reply